Two resistors, 15 Ω and 10Ω, are connected in parallel across a 6 V battery. What is the current flowing through the 15 Ω resistor?A0.4 AB1AC0.6AD2.5AAnswer: A. 0.4 A Read Explanation: To find the current flowing through the 15 Ω resistor, we can use the formula:I = V/RWhere:I = current through the resistorV = voltage across the resistorR = resistance of the resistorGiven:V = 6 VR = 15 ΩPlugging in the values:I = 6 V / 15 ΩI = 0.4 ASo, the current flowing through the 15 Ω resistor is 0.4 A.
